The utility model discloses a power dispersion type EMU pressure switch feedback detection special frock belongs to pressure switch detection technical field. The wire connection mode of battery compartment and switch plug has ensured the stability of power supply, and the series structure of LED light emitting diode and color ring resistance has formed the clear on-off indication loop, when the pressure switch contact closes, the current forms the complete loop through battery compartment anode, switch plug contact, LED light emitting diode and color ring resistance, and whether the pressure switch function is normal is directly reacted through the bright and dark state of LED, avoids the defect that auditory signal is disturbed by environment, and the standardization butt joint design of special plug assembly and pressure switch pin reduces the operation complexity, improves the environmental adaptability and result consistency of detection process, fundamentally reduces the misjudgment risk caused by human factor, and provides reliable, efficient special solution for EMU brake system pressure switch detection.
